Concordia College Library’s digital collections are available through Digital Horizons, a regional digital consortium created by the Concordia College Library, the NDSU Libraries’ Institute for Regional Studies & University Archives, Prairie Public Broadcasting, and the State Historical Society of North Dakota. The collections in Digital Horizons contain thousands of images, documents, video, and oral histories depicting life on the Northern Plains from the late 1800s to today from all of the participating organizations.

Concordia Revealed: A Photograph Collection
This collection contains photographs from Concordia from 1891 to 1920.

Concordia College Master's Theses
This collection contains the theses from graduates of the Master of Education on World Language Instruction.

Concordia College Institutional Repository for Undergraduate Research
This collection gathers, disseminates, and preserves examples of exemplary research of Concordia College students. Learn more about the collection or submit your contribution.
